Fort Pierce Overview
Fort Pierce city is located on the East Coast of Florida. The city is known for the National Navy Seal museum that displays vehicles, weapons, and other naval artifacts. Fort Pierce is a lively city with many recreational activities going on with a wide range of affordable luxury apartments.
Why live in Fort Pierce, FL?
Fort Pierce is best referred to as the Sunrise City and for over 100 years, has been the hub of St. Lucie County, Florida. It is a small city constructed on the water and provides the best site for swimming, speed-boating, skiing, and fishing. You also get a chance in modernized condos in Fort Pierced. Tourists from different parts of the globe come here annually, making it the best place to be if you love to mingle and learn about new cultures. If you didn’t know, Fort Pierce is known to be one of the oldest communities located on the east coast of Florida.
